    Diamagnetism (?), n.
    1. The science which treats of diamagnetic phenomena, and of the properties of diamagnetic bodies.

    [1913 Webster]


    2. The magnetic action which characterizes diamagnetic substances, the magnetic moments of which tend to oppose an externally applied magnetic field. Contrasted with paramagnetism and ferromagnetism.

    [1913 Webster +PJC]
